From 7376aee3057dfd4075674d715811bc7f11bc3912 Mon Sep 17 00:00:00 2001 From: Bruno Ribas Date: Wed, 8 Mar 2023 22:30:43 -0300 Subject: src/db.php: Begin migration to php8.1 requirement. Fix use of pg_lo_export Signed-off-by: Bruno Ribas --- src/db.php |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/db.php b/src/db.php index c43816f..0bd6d74 100644 --- a/src/db.php +++ b/src/db.php @@ -89,11 +89,11 @@ function DB_lo_import_text($conn, $text) { return $oid; } +//a função sofreu modificações importantes na versão 8.1 do php. A +//partir deste commit vamos exigir o uso de php8.1 function DB_lo_export($contest, $conn, $oid, $file) { - if (strcmp(phpversion(),'4.2.0')<0) - $stat= pg_loexport ($oid, $file, $conn); - else - $stat= pg_lo_export ($oid, $file, $conn); + $stat= pg_lo_export ($conn, $oid, $file); + if($stat===false) return false; if(!is_readable($file)) return false; if(($str=DB_unlock($contest,file_get_contents($file),$conn))!==false) { -- cgit v1.2.3